I thought I'd take a few minutes to tell people about what, in my opinion, is a local institution - Tigersharks http://www.tigersharksswimmingclub.co.uk/


Both of my kids learnt to swim with tigersharks and they managed to get me back in the pool after nearly 30 years.


The club is run like any other swmimming club, but with the exception that it doesn't have a competitive team - so theres no pressure to train 6 times per week ! - its open to both kids and adults


I swim twice a week (Monday & Thurs 8-9pm), the coach Kris is an ex-national swimmer. It is a solid 60 minute workout. The people in that timeslot mainly teenagers, adults people who used to swim competitively when they were younger (like me) or people who just want to improve their swimming. Quite a few people use tigersharks to train for triathlons


The earlier sessions (7-8pm) is mainly kids, from beginners upwards. There are weekend sessions too.


I have no connection to the club (other than swimming there) - but they have been struggling for numbers recently. Hoping that a few people here can give it a go and realise what an amazing way of keeping fit it is - and that they can take their kids to swimming lessons AND keep fit themselves at the same time


Its based at Alleyns. Just turn up at one of the above times
